Definition
Unheedy: adjective describing a person who is inattentive or oblivious to warnings or potential dangers.
Sample Sentences
- The unheedy traveler wandered into the dense forest, oblivious to the warnings of dangerous wildlife.
- Despite the storm brewing on the horizon, he remained unheedy, focused solely on his fishing line.
- Her unheedy nature often led her into trouble, as she rarely considered the consequences of her actions.
- The unheedy driver sped through the intersection, completely unaware of the red light flashing above.
- In his unheedy pursuit of success, he neglected the importance of maintaining relationships with his friends.
